Warning Signs You Need Pool Leak Water Removal
Ignoring pool leaks can lead to costly repairs and even safety hazards. Here are some warning signs to look out for: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ors can show a leak in your pool’s plumbing or equipment. If you notice a persistent musty smell, it’s essential to investigate further.
Water Bill Surges
Unexplained increases in your water bill can be a sign of a leak in your pool. If you notice a sudden spike in your water usage, it’s time to investigate.
Visible Water Damage
Visible signs of water damage, such as cracks, stains, or warping, can show a leak in your pool’s structure. Don’t ignore these signs, they can lead to more extensive and costly repairs.
Equipment Malfunction
Leaks can cause your pool equipment to malfunction, leading to costly repairs and even safety hazards. If you notice any issues with your pool’s equipment, it’s essential to investigate further.
Unusual Pool Behavior
Leaks can cause your pool to behave erratically, including changes in water level, temperature, or chemistry. If you notice any unusual behavior, it’s time to investigate.
Visible Signs of Erosion
Leaks can cause erosion around your pool, including cracks, stains, or warping. Don’t ignore these signs, they can lead to more extensive and costly repairs.
Pool Leak Water Removal v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small leak in pool equipment | Yes | No | You can fix small leaks with basic tools and knowledge. |
| Visible water damage around pool | No | Yes | Visible damage can show a more extensive leak, needing professional attention. |
| Musty odors in pool area | Maybe | Yes | Musty odors can show a leak in pool plumbing or equipment, needing professional investigation. |
| Unexplained water bill surge | No | Yes | Unexplained increases in water bills can show a leak, needing professional attention. |
| Leak in pool structure | No | Yes | Leaks in pool structure can cause safety hazards and need professional repair. |
| Pool equipment malfunction | Maybe | Yes | Leaks can cause equipment malfunctions, needing professional investigation and repair. |
